AccessHealth Tri-County Network The mission of AHTN is to coordinate a sustainable provider network of care for low-income uninsured residents of Berkeley, Charleston and Dorchester counties.

AHTN is a community program that provides care coordination to low income individuals not covered by health insurance and who do not have a doctor or medical home. By connecting the Lowcountry’s low income, uninsured residents to a medical home, we are able to better meet their primary care needs and, in turn, improve the health of our community.
